An Athy, Co Kildare man has been fondly remembered as “a true gentleman.”
Tom Joe Bradley, 9 St Patrick's Avenue, Athy, Kildare – formerly of Timahoe, Co Laois – passed peacefully on September 23 last in the loving care of Tallaght University Hospital.
Deeply regretted by his loving wife Marjorie, son Seán and his partner LaToya, daughter Catherine, grandchildren Jack, Sophia, Cian and Sam, relatives and friends.
Rest in Peace
Reposing at his daughter Catherine's residence, 4 Ashville, Athy (R14 X998) on Thursday afternoon (September 25) from 4pm until the conclusion of the Rosary at 8pm.
Removal at 1.30pm on Friday afternoon (September 26) to arrive at St. Michael's Parish Church, Athy for Requiem Mass at 2pm, see livestream link http://www.parishofathy.ie
Burial afterwards in Michael's New Cemetery, Athy.
